Monday, November 19, 2007CREATE UNIQUE GIFTS IN PETITE PICASSOS FOR THE HOLIDAYS
LAWRENCE – Space is still available in Petite Picassos for the Holidays, a holiday-themed art class for children ages 1-2 and a parent or caregiver.
Each child will paint three 8"x10" canvas boards using the colors of the holiday his or her family celebrates, and create a simple holiday craft. All of these projects will make perfect gifts.
Lawrence Parks and Recreation Department is offering several sessions of Petite Picassos. The class will be offered from 5:30 to 6 p.m. and 6:15 to 6:45 p.m. on Monday, Dec. 3, and from 9:30 to 10 a.m. and 10:15-10:45 a.m. on Saturday, Dec. 8, at the Community Building, 115 W. 11th St. The fee for the class is $12.
